'wes'onah

kyah rise (sun or moon), spring (season), vernal

kechee' it is daylight

wonewsleg moon, sun

'wes'onew sky

wonoye'eek in the sky, up in the middle of the sky

hoogech star

rootah sun ray

ye'womey' the sun sets

chmeyonen hoogech evening star

hoogech neeen' astronomer

hoogech 'ue-m falling star

hoogechoy be starry (night)

koypoh hoogech morning star

kuereesh the end of a net, the point of a V-shaped mark, used for calendar keeping, made in a slate slab in the floor of a sweat-house

lekonee hoogech falling star, shooting star

mehl seges'ew shooting star

ruerowech dance in a particular direction, move across the sky (of stars)

so'oo 'we-laay Milky Way

yew' the sun sets

'or' it is the first sliver of the new moon

Dictionary entry

'wes'onahn • sky, horizon • world • cosmos • earth, universe

Lexicon record # 4082 | Source references: R263 JE121 YM116 YSRO477 MPY198 FS(B219)
Semantic domain: astronomy and the sky

Other paradigm form

  • locative 'wes'oneweek earth, universe FS(B219)

Special meanings or uses

  • 'wes'onah 'we-lekeeta' Milky Way [literally, "sky's backbone"] CS(ALK9:55) [astronomy and the sky]

  • k'ee 'wes'onah megetohl mythological character, "the keeper of the heavens" FS(B219) HIC74 YM313 • "Sky-Keeper; he who has or owns the sky" YM431
